ponytracker/sources
Majora 3cdcc213fa Voici la fonction lecture. Elle initialise l'audio, ouvre un nombre de chaines audio défini en argument, et importe les samples (ici Square et Saw).
Ensuite elle va chercher les notes du morceau à jouer avec getInstrument (corrige-moi si je me suis gourré Guy) et elle les lit un à un en balayant les chaines et en jouant les samples
correspondants au numéro de la chaine (ici aussi je sais pas si j'ai merdé ou pas avec les pointeurs les adresses etc...)

On ne se sert pas du tout du module "instrument" mais c'est pas plus mal. Le module instrument risque de ne servir qu'à la création d'instrument (numéro de chaine et/ou de sample à importer)
plus tard.
2014-04-07 20:51:04 +02:00
..
GUI De la part d'Abramo : ajout des fichiers Glade 2014-04-02 20:02:28 +02:00
instrument Ajout du module Instrument 1.0 2014-04-05 10:34:16 +02:00
lecture Voici la fonction lecture. Elle initialise l'audio, ouvre un nombre de chaines audio défini en argument, et importe les samples (ici Square et Saw). 2014-04-07 20:51:04 +02:00
melodie Commit important : maintenant, y a des trucs qui marchent :) 2014-04-06 20:08:43 +02:00
motifs Suppression des lignes de debug, ajout de getters 2014-04-06 20:26:20 +02:00
Makefile Commit important : maintenant, y a des trucs qui marchent :) 2014-04-06 20:08:43 +02:00
TODO_fonctions Création module mélodie, ajout d'un module dans la TODO liste... 2014-04-01 21:31:20 +02:00
main.c J'ai rangé le main. Mika, à toi de jouer. 2014-04-07 16:03:08 +02:00